Second Life: REPURPOSING YOUR WEDDING SUIT Give your special day attire more than one life Your wedding day may be one of the most important days of your life, but what happens to that beautiful suit afterwards? While wedding dresses often become treasured keepsakes stored away for decades, your wedding suit has the potential for a much more practical future. Jake Allen, co-founder and CEO of King & Allen, highlights how more couples are futureproofing their wedding attire from the very beginning, ensuring their investment pays dividends long after the confetti has been swept away. PLANNING FOR THE FUTURE FROM DAY ONE The key to maximising your wedding suit’s potential lies in the initial planning process. “We encourage people to look beyond the wedding outfit as a one-day wonder and instead make it a wardrobe cornerstone” says Jake. The secret is understanding your existing style before you make any decisions. The initial process involves identifying key pieces already in your wardrobe that can inform your suit choice. It is easy to be distracted by the trends, but your existing wardrobe tells you everything you need to know about your own personal style; ensuring your wedding suit naturally integrates with your look, rather than sitting as an isolated formal piece. CREATIVE STYLING FOR EVERY OCCASION The versatility of a well-chosen wedding suit extends far beyond formal events. Each component can be styled separately to create entirely different looks. Summer casual: Pair the waistcoat with a simple t-shirt for an unexpectedly sophisticated warm-weather look that bridges smart and casual perfectly. Garden party perfect: The jacket transforms any outfit. Wear it with jeans and a t-shirt for dinner events, garden parties, or even barbecues. The contrast between formal tailoring and casual basics creates an effortlessly stylish aesthetic. Weekend comfort: The trousers work beautifully with trainers and a casual top, offering a more polished alternative to standard casual wear, while remaining comfortable for everyday activities. Evening elegance: A tailored jacket can even replace a shawl or overcoat when worn over an evening gown, creating a striking modern formal look. The power of accessories shouldn’t be underestimated either. A well-chosen pocket square can eliminate the need for a tie while adding a dapper touch, even when worn with jeans and a t-shirt.
